| rheumatoid factor |
a protein found in the blood of 80% of adults diagnosed with RA.

| rheumatoid nodule |
a lump under the skin that may develop in people with RA.

| rheumatoid arthritis |
A disease in which the immune system is believed to attack the linings of the joints. This results in joint pain, stiffness, swelling, and destruction.

| rheumatoid arthritis |
Chronic inflammatory disease that affects the connective tissues. RA can cause pain, swelling, stiffness, and loss of function in the joints.
